Also, while I am a fan of the East End and North Side of the island, it is a bit out of the way to go just for food when visiting on a cruise IMO. If heading to the Botanical Gardens or other Eastern District destinations then by all means include the other areas as options. If not, I would stick to George Town, Seven Mile Beach and West Bay locations.
